Health Tested Puppies
Health testing is an important step in responsible breeding. This helps breeders discover heritable disease in breeding stock, and decrease the likelihood that these diseases will pass to their offspring. This is essential for the long-term health of the breed as well as ensuring that puppies are raised in a healthy environment. When choosing a reputable dog breeder, look for one that tests the health of both parents in their litters.
The Orthopedic Foundation for Animals recommends screening for a number of commonly-occurring genetic diseases, französische bulldogge kaufen berlin like hip dysplasia and heart disease. Breeders with good reputations will perform OFA-recommended health testing on the parents of their pups and will provide this information to prospective puppy buyers.

Socialized Puppies
French Bulldogs are loyal dogs that thrive on the attention of others. They bond closely with their families and enjoy spending time with them. However, they are also lively and active dogs who want to have fun. If you're looking for a Frenchie puppy to add to your family make sure you select a breeder who is aware of the importance socialization.
This is how a puppy learns to behave with other dogs. It's a critical part of their development, and should take place from three to seven weeks old and French Bulldog the puppies stay with Mom for this time. When it is time for the puppies to leave the litter, they must be gradually introduced to other dogs. They'll play first with their littermates, and as they grow older, französische bulldogge welpen their play will include other puppies.
You can now introduce them to other humans however, only in a controlled manner. You should allow your puppy to learn to be comfortable with different textures, sounds and objects before bringing them into your home. You can do this if you put objects on the floor, such as winter boots, skateboards and bags of food. You can also use blankets, rugs and rugs. It is also important to expose them to household noises like blenders, doorbells, banging pots and alarm clocks. Introduce them to these sounds as soon as possible before you get your new Frenchie. The more they are exposed to and experience when they are young, the less likely it is that they will be afraid of them in the future.
Introduce them to all types of environments, such as busy streets and parks. This will allow them to cope with the bizarre sounds and sights of the world of humans when they're older. If they're not exposed things when they're young, they may freak out over the sight of statues in parks or children, or having their nails trimmed.
